Taliban leader claims Afghan women given ‘comfortable and prosperous life’
The leader of the Taliban said his government in Afghanistan has taken the necessary steps for the betterment of women’s lives (Ebrahim Noroozi/AP)

The supreme leader of the Taliban has claimed his government has taken the necessary steps for the betterment of women’s lives in Afghanistan, where women are banned from public life and work and girls’ education is severely curtailed.

The statement from Hibatullah Akhundzada was made public on Sunday ahead of the Eid al-Adha holiday, which will be celebrated later this week in Afghanistan and other Islamic countries.
